Do you need to register a claim?

  • Notification of the claim must be made to the Company as soon as the loss occurs
  • Thereafter a claim form will be dispatched by mail for completion
  • The claim form must be supported by all necessary documentation/reports/estimates
  • Upon receipt of all the above, the company will be in a position to consider the claim submitted in the light of the Policy wording.

Kindly note that Insurers, their Agents and Insurance Associations share information with each other to prevent fraudulent claims and for underwriting purposes. In the event of a claim, some or all of the information you supply in this form and in the claim form together with other information relating to the claim may be provided to other Insurers, their Agents and Insurance Associations.
